1st Forum for Film Education

The Forum for Film Education takes place on 27–28 November 2025 at the Department of Media Studies of the University of Amsterdam, hosted in the historic Chirurgisch Theater, and is organised by Film Studies staff member Blandine Joret and Thijs Witty (Leiden University). This inaugural forum brings together scholars, educators, curators, filmmakers, and practitioners from across disciplines to explore the evolving landscape of film pedagogy, from early screen education to adult media literacy. Over two days, the programme features a keynote lecture by Jan Masschelein (KU Leuven), three panels, two roundtable discussions, and a range of side events including a VR installation and a toddler film screening. Contributions from international researchers and practitioners address film literacy, pedagogical approaches, and archival and curatorial practices.
